## **Core Concept**
The question revolves around the diagnosis of a pathological fracture in a patient with chronic renal failure (CRF). Pathological fractures occur in weakened bones due to various conditions. In CRF, several factors contribute to bone disease, notably **renal osteodystrophy**, which encompasses a spectrum of skeletal abnormalities.

## **Clinical Pearl / High-Yield Fact**
In patients with chronic renal failure, **renal osteodystrophy** is a significant concern, encompassing a range of bone lesions including osteitis fibrosa cystica (high turnover), osteomalacia (low turnover), adynamic bone disease, and mixed uremic osteodystrophy. The risk of **pathological fractures** is increased in these patients due to bone mineralization defects and secondary hyperparathyroidism.
